Pingtian Lake Scenic Area consists of five parts: Qishan, Bishan, Pingtian Lake, Wetland and Taoyuan. It integrates mountains, water and wetlands, with beautiful natural scenery and profound cultural heritage.

Pingtian Lake, formerly known as Baisha Lake. The lake is now known as Pingtian Lake because of the Tang Dynasty poet Li Bai who visited Jiuhua three times and Qiupu five times while wandering in Chizhou a thousand years ago. He wrote the immortal quatrain "The water is like a silk ribbon, this place is Pingtian. You can ride on the bright moon and watch the flowers on a wine boat" by the lake. Later generations renamed it Pingtian Lake.

When you walk through Pingtian Lake Tianlu and Pingtian Lake Lotus Terrace, you can see the "Wanghua Tower" from afar. The Wanghua Tower is located in a unique scenic location on the top of a green mountain, echoing the Pingtian Lake Lotus Terrace from a distance, and is on the same central axis as Qiupu Road and Lotus Terrace in the main urban area of ​​Chizhou. Standing on the Wanghua Tower, you can see the main peak of Jiuhua Mountain, standing tall above the land of southern Anhui.
